The National Institute of General
Medical Sciences (NIGMS) solicits applications to maintain and enhance the Protein
Structure Initiative (PSI)-Structural Genomics Knowledgebase, a central
information hub that plays a critical role in making the research of PSI:Biology widely available and that performs outreach
activities to increase the impact of PSI:Biology. NIGMS
expects to make one award up to $2.8 million annual total costs per year for a
period of five years.
